Military installation
The , literally the "National Gendarmerie Military Academy"), the French Gendarmerie nationale officers school, was created in 1901 and is based in . is situated 1 km south of Plaine de Montaigu.

Village
is a commune in the department, in the region in north-central . A little village, located 39 kilometers south-east from the center of Paris, was mainly known for its 12th century abbey, and then for its renowned local figure, Claude-Henri de Fusée de , academician and abbot.
